Locust Lick Branch
Locust Lick Branch is a stream in Taylor, Kentucky. Locust Lick Branch is situated nearby to the hamlet Bengal, as well as near Pitman.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Bengal
Hamlet
Bengal is an unincorporated community in Taylor County, Kentucky, United States. Located west of the city of Campbellsville, the county seat of Taylor County, it is served by Bengal Road from Campbellsville and by Route 323. Its elevation is 722 feet.
Black Gnat
Hamlet
Black Gnat is an unincorporated community in Green and Taylor Counties in the U.S. state of Kentucky. It lies along Old U.S. Route 68 between the cities of Campbellsville and Greensburg, the county seats of Taylor and Green Counties. Black Gnat is situated 4½ miles south of Locust Lick Branch.
Saloma
Hamlet

Saloma is an unincorporated community in Taylor County, Kentucky, United States. It lies along Routes 527 and 744 northwest of the city of Campbellsville, the county seat of Taylor County. Saloma is situated 5 miles northeast of Locust Lick Branch.
